vue里disabled的含义

2025-01-09 20:36:16   小编

vue里disabled的含义

在Vue.js的开发中,disabled是一个常见且重要的属性,它在表单元素以及一些交互组件中发挥着关键作用。

从表单元素的角度来看,disabled属性用于控制元素是否可被用户操作。例如,在一个输入框(input)元素中,当设置了disabled属性为true时,该输入框将变为灰色,并且用户无法在其中输入任何内容。同样,对于按钮(button)元素,设置disabled为true会使其无法被点击,这在某些特定场景下非常有用。比如,当用户提交表单后,为了防止重复提交,可以将提交按钮设置为disabled状态,直到服务器返回响应。

在Vue中,我们可以通过数据绑定的方式动态地控制disabled属性。这意味着我们可以根据应用程序的状态来决定元素是否可用。例如,我们可以定义一个数据属性isDisabled,然后将其绑定到表单元素的disabled属性上。当isDisabled的值为true时,元素将被禁用;当值为false时,元素将变为可用状态。这种动态控制的方式使得我们能够根据用户的操作或者业务逻辑来灵活地改变元素的可用性。

除了表单元素,disabled属性在一些自定义组件中也经常被使用。例如,在一个自定义的日期选择器组件中,我们可能希望在某些特定条件下禁止用户选择日期,这时就可以通过设置disabled属性来实现。

需要注意的是,当一个元素被设置为disabled状态时,它通常不会触发任何用户交互事件。例如,点击一个被禁用的按钮不会触发点击事件。这是因为disabled元素的目的就是阻止用户的操作,以避免不必要的行为。

在Vue的开发中,理解和正确使用disabled属性对于构建用户友好且功能完善的应用程序至关重要。它能够帮助我们控制用户的操作,提高应用程序的稳定性和可靠性,同时也能提升用户体验,让用户更加清晰地了解哪些操作是当前可用的,哪些是不可用的。通过合理地运用disabled属性,我们可以打造出更加专业和高效的Vue应用。

TAGS: Vue特性 vue属性 vue_disabled含义 disabled属性应用

欢迎使用万千站长工具!

Welcome to www.zzTool.com